General Rules
In Jonesville, roofing permits are typically required for projects that impact structural integrity, fire safety, or weather resistance.
Local authorities enforce these to prevent issues like leaks or collapses.
Always confirm specifics with the building department for your residential or commercial property.
When Permits Are Required
Permits are often required for:
- Full roof replacements or overlaying existing roofing
- Structural alterations like changing roof pitch or adding skylights
- Commercial installations involving HVAC or large spans
- Any work exceeding minor repairs (e.g., over 25% of roof area)
Common Exemptions
Common exemptions:
- Replacing a few shingles or patching small leaks
- Cleaning gutters or minor maintenance
- Like-for-like repairs without structural changes
Even exempt work must meet code standards – verify locally.

Permit Process
Step 1: Assess Your Project
Determine scope and check if a permit is needed by reviewing guidelines or calling the local building department. Note your address, roof size, and materials.
Step 2: Gather Documentation
Prepare plans, contractor details, product specs, and property info. Licensed pros often assist here.
Step 3: Submit Application
File via online portal, mail, or in-person. Include fees based on project value.
Step 4: Undergo Inspections
Start work post-approval; schedule checks for rough-in and final. Obtain approval sticker or certificate.

Special Considerations
HOA Rules
HOA Rules: Many Jonesville neighborhoods have HOAs requiring approval for roofing colors, materials, or styles before city permits.
Submit plans to your HOA first.
Zoning
Zoning Check: Residential vs. commercial zones may restrict materials like reflective or green roofs.
Confirm allowed uses for compliance.
Historic Properties
Historic Districts: If applicable, extra reviews ensure materials match period aesthetics.
Check your property's status with county records.
